 Three killed celebrating Basant in Punjab
 Updated at: 0623 PST,  Saturday, February 28, 2009
Three killed celebrating Basant in Punjab LAHORE: Three people lost their lives and scores others were injured while celebrating Basant festival in various cities of Punjab on Friday.

Five seriously injured were admitted to a local hospital.

According to details, three men were killed in separate incidents of falling off roofs and firing in Sargodha, Shorkot and Kamonki.

Basant was celebrated in different parts of Punjab including Shaikhupura, Kasoor, Sahiwal and Okara in spite of the ban.

Firing amid Basant celebration in Kamonki killed a teenaged girl while two young men died after falling off a roof in Sargodha and Shorkot.

Similarly, more than 40 people were injured while flying kites or running after them in Kasoor, 5 of them injured critically were shifted to the General Hospital Lahore.
